I love the fact that I can drop an AVI into Helicon and it will stack it as a "rack focus" move. But I can't seem to find a way to do that through the Batch UI or through the command line arguments. Is this scenario supported, and if not, are there any workaround I can try? The AVI is such a tidy container for the process I'm using that I'd rather not have to explode it into a collection of frames for stacking if I don't have to.

You are unfortunately correct in your findings, video files are not currently supported both in batch mode nor command line mode. It's on our to-do list but I don't know when we'll get to it. It's certainly possible to implement, but not trivial. I'll bump it up on the to-do list.
